Let’s chat. You might recognize these socks. Nope, I’m not making a second pair. I ripped my first pair completely out and I’m starting again. I THOUGHT these fit when I finished them. Then I quickly realized they were huge. Not in length, but in width. I’ve knit several pairs of socks up to this point and really assumed that since I was using the same needle size and same yarn weight that I’ve used in the past that I could just pick my size from this designer and go.

🚫 WRONG ❗️🚫

According to my measurements for this designer I should have chosen the size large. I was trying to figure out how these could have gone so sideways when the obvious dawned on me. Gauge. So I checked these socks AND all previous socks. My gauge was 8.5 stitches per inch with a US 1 needle. Then I checked hers: 9.5 stitches per inch. 🤦🏽‍♀️

Knitting tighter isn’t going to work for me. I then figured out that she must be calculating her cast on number by multiplying her gauge x 7.5 inches, which would make me a large in her gauge. So I calculated MY gauge by 7.5 inches and I come out to a size medium, the cast on stitches are a close match to all my other socks, and these are looking LOADS better.

So my point is: don’t blindly think that just because a designer is using the same needle size as you have used many times before with the same size yarn that you’ve used before that the sizing matches. Make yourself a note as to what your stitches per inch are in all other projects in that yarn and needle size so that you don’t find yourself ripping out fully finished socks 🧦 and re-knitting them 🫠😂

Honestly though - this was a really great learning experience and I’m not mad about having to knit these again.
